BlackRock, Vanguard and State Street Sued by 11 States

News November 27, 2024 at 02:04 PM
Share & Print

What You Need To Know

  • Texas and other states say the asset managers broke antitrust laws by boosting electricity prices through their investments.
  • Attorney General Bill Paxton accuses the firms of working together to cause industrywide reductions in coal production, which has resulted in higher energy prices.
  • Republican lawmakers have been critical of Wall Street’s efforts to include environmental and social factors in their financial calculations.
